You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@eventmesh.apache.org by mi...@apache.org on 2022/07/13 06:44:37 UTC

[incubator-eventmesh] branch redis-connector updated (dab10863 -> ef4a5d8c)

This is an automated email from the ASF dual-hosted git repository.

mikexue pushed a change to branch redis-connector
in repository https://gitbox.apache.org/repos/asf/incubator-eventmesh.git


    from dab10863 Merge pull request #963 from lrhkobe/trace_improve_3
     new dfe58f5b Update slack link in README (#972)
     new 74c182b0 When trace enable, then get trace plugin.
     new 5d88529e Implement the redis connector plugin.
     new 36685c7c Remove invalid import.
     new 73ee8269 Introduce redis-mock tool and test case optimization.
     new c9934944 Check style problem fix.
     new cf393a4b Check style problem fix & License Check problem fix
     new a098bb9f Add known dependencies & Add LICENSE
     new 7551c86e Add known dependencies problem fix
     new f2ae8ddc Code optimize.
     new a1135ba2 Build (macOS-latest, 8) testSendOneway FAILED fix.
     new e9ec31cf Partial modification recovery and code optimization.
     new 1006bf26 Review suggestion: remove the unified configuration function.
     new ef4a5d8c Merge pull request #990 from mytang0/feature/redis-connector

The 1084 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ails.  The revisions
listed as "add" were already present in the repository and have only
been added to this reference.


Summary of changes:
 README.md                                          |   4 +-
 .../org/apache/eventmesh/common/Constants.java     |  38 ++++++
 .../common/config/CommonConfiguration.java         |   4 +-
 .../eventmesh/common/utils/PropertiesUtils.java    |  64 +++++++++
 .../common/utils/PropertiesUtilsTest.java          |  43 ++++++
 .../build.gradle                                   |  25 ++++
 .../gradle.properties                              |   2 +-
 .../connector/redis/client/RedissonClient.java     | 148 +++++++++++++++++++++
 .../redis/cloudevent/CloudEventCodec.java          |  60 +++++++++
 .../connector/redis/config/ConfigOptions.java      |  51 +++++++
 .../redis}/config/ConfigurationWrapper.java        |  48 +++----
 .../connector/redis/config/RedisProperties.java    |  94 +++++++++++++
 .../connector/RedisConnectorResourceService.java}  |  14 +-
 .../connector/redis/consumer/RedisConsumer.java    | 131 ++++++++++++++++++
 .../connector/redis/producer/RedisProducer.java    | 139 +++++++++++++++++++
 ...entmesh.api.connector.ConnectorResourceService} |   6 +-
 .../org.apache.eventmesh.api.consumer.Consumer     |   4 +-
 .../org.apache.eventmesh.api.producer.Producer     |   4 +-
 .../src/main/resources/redis-client.properties     |   1 +
 .../connector/redis/AbstractRedisServer.java       |  41 ++++++
 .../redis/client/RedissonClientTest.java}          |  28 ++--
 .../connector/redis/connector/UnitTest.java        | 109 +++++++++++++++
 .../redis/consumer/RedisConsumerTest.java          |  90 +++++++++++++
 .../redis/producer/RedisProducerTest.java          | 109 +++++++++++++++
 .../src/test/resources/redis-client.properties     |   2 +-
 settings.gradle                                    |   1 +
 tools/dependency-check/check-dependencies.sh       |   2 +-
 tools/dependency-check/known-dependencies.txt      |  13 +-
 .../licenses/java/LICENSE-redisson.txt             |  13 ++
 29 files changed, 1222 insertions(+), 66 deletions(-)
 create mode 100644 eventmesh-common/src/main/java/org/apache/eventmesh/common/utils/PropertiesUtils.java
 create mode 100644 eventmesh-common/src/test/java/org/apache/eventmesh/common/utils/PropertiesUtilsTest.java
 copy eventmesh-connector-plugin/{eventmesh-connector-standalone => eventmesh-connector-redis}/build.gradle (52%)
 copy eventmesh-connector-plugin/{eventmesh-connector-standalone => eventmesh-connector-redis}/gradle.properties (97%)
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/main/java/org/apache/eventmesh/connector/redis/client/RedissonClient.java
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/main/java/org/apache/eventmesh/connector/redis/cloudevent/CloudEventCodec.java
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/main/java/org/apache/eventmesh/connector/redis/config/ConfigOptions.java
 copy eventmesh-connector-plugin/{eventmesh-connector-rocketmq/src/main/java/org/apache/eventmesh/connector/rocketmq => eventmesh-connector-redis/src/main/java/org/apache/eventmesh/connector/redis}/config/ConfigurationWrapper.java (55%)
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/main/java/org/apache/eventmesh/connector/redis/config/RedisProperties.java
 copy eventmesh-connector-plugin/{eventmesh-connector-standalone/src/main/java/org/apache/eventmesh/connector/standalone/resource/StandaloneConnectorResourceService.java => eventmesh-connector-redis/src/main/java/org/apache/eventmesh/connector/redis/connector/RedisConnectorResourceService.java} (59%)
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/main/java/org/apache/eventmesh/connector/redis/consumer/RedisConsumer.java
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/main/java/org/apache/eventmesh/connector/redis/producer/RedisProducer.java
 copy eventmesh-connector-plugin/{eventmesh-connector-rocketmq/gradle.properties => eventmesh-connector-redis/src/main/resources/META-INF/eventmesh/org.apache.eventmesh.api.connector.ConnectorResourceService} (90%)
 copy eventmesh-metrics-plugin/eventmesh-metrics-prometheus/src/test/resources/prometheus.properties => eventmesh-connector-plugin/eventmesh-connector-redis/src/main/resources/META-INF/eventmesh/org.apache.eventmesh.api.consumer.Consumer (92%)
 copy eventmesh-metrics-plugin/eventmesh-metrics-prometheus/src/test/resources/prometheus.properties => eventmesh-connector-plugin/eventmesh-connector-redis/src/main/resources/META-INF/eventmesh/org.apache.eventmesh.api.producer.Producer (92%)
 copy eventmesh-examples/gradle.properties => eventmesh-connector-plugin/eventmesh-connector-redis/src/main/resources/redis-client.properties (99%)
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/test/java/org/apache/eventmesh/connector/redis/AbstractRedisServer.java
 copy eventmesh-connector-plugin/{eventmesh-connector-rocketmq/src/main/java/org/apache/eventmesh/connector/rocketmq/cloudevent/impl/RocketMQHeaders.java => eventmesh-connector-redis/src/test/java/org/apache/eventmesh/connector/redis/client/RedissonClientTest.java} (56%)
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/test/java/org/apache/eventmesh/connector/redis/connector/UnitTest.java
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/test/java/org/apache/eventmesh/connector/redis/consumer/RedisConsumerTest.java
 create mode 100644 eventmesh-connector-plugin/eventmesh-connector-redis/src/test/java/org/apache/eventmesh/connector/redis/producer/RedisProducerTest.java
 copy eventmesh-metrics-plugin/eventmesh-metrics-prometheus/src/test/resources/prometheus.properties => eventmesh-connector-plugin/eventmesh-connector-redis/src/test/resources/redis-client.properties (93%)
 create mode 100644 tools/third-party-licenses/licenses/java/LICENSE-redisson.txt


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@eventmesh.apache.org
For additional commands, e-mail: commits-help@eventmesh.apache.org